About

Elisabetta Pezzati is a scholar working on Endocrinology, Immunology and Ecology. According to data from OpenAlex, Elisabetta Pezzati has authored 19 papers receiving a total of 904 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Endocrinology, 10 papers in Immunology and 5 papers in Ecology. Recurrent topics in Elisabetta Pezzati's work include Vibrio bacteria research studies (11 papers), Aquaculture disease management and microbiota (10 papers) and Marine Bivalve and Aquaculture Studies (5 papers). Elisabetta Pezzati is often cited by papers focused on Vibrio bacteria research studies (11 papers), Aquaculture disease management and microbiota (10 papers) and Marine Bivalve and Aquaculture Studies (5 papers). Elisabetta Pezzati collaborates with scholars based in Italy, United Kingdom and United States. Elisabetta Pezzati's co-authors include Luigi Vezzulli, Carla Pruzzo, Manfred G. Höfle, Ingrid Brettar, Monica Stauder, Rita R. Colwell, Mariapaola Moreno, M. Fabiano, Philip C. Reid and Luigi Pane and has published in prestigious journals such as PLoS ONE, Frontiers in Microbiology and The ISME Journal.
